Thomas Lillis Obituary

Thomas F. Lillis, III
Thomas F. Lillis, III, 82 of Fairfield, the beloved husband of Georgianna (Gutheinz) Lillis, passed away on Wednesday, November 23, 20222. He was born in New Haven to the late Mary Florence and Thomas F. Lillis, Jr. and was a U.S. Army veteran having served during the Vietnam War.
Tom earned a bachelor's degree from UCONN and an MBA from University of New Haven. He had a successful career in marketing and retired from Enthone, Inc. In retirement, he was a bus driver for Fairfield Prep and truly enjoyed bantering with the boys.
Tom was the past president of the Fair Acres Association and actively represented the neighborhood for many years. He attended many summer concerts at Tanglewood and was a longtime subscriber to seasons at the Long Wharf and Yale Repertory Theatres. He was a great fan of Ohio State Buckeye football and the UCONN women's basketball team and a longtime member of the Gaelic American Club. Involved with his sons' day to day activities, he had fond memories of participating in the Indian Guides program with each of them.
In addition to his wife, Tom is survived by his son, Thomas F. Lillis, IV and his wife Judy of Columbus, OH and Matthew E. Lillis and his wife Yvonne of Austin, TX. He will also be missed by his siblings, Mary Ellen Koalchic and her husband Richard of Seymour, Brian Lillis and his wife Judy of Brookfield, CO and Margaret Sugar of Montgomery Village, MD; as well as grandsons, Thomas F. Lillis, V of Columbus and Logan Lillis of Austin, and sister-in-law, Ellen Lillis of San Ramon, CA.
Tom was predeceased by his son, Jason S. Lillis and his brother, David Lillis.
